The beauty of Oregonian Pinot Noir is that it has the magic trifecta - the soil, the climate and the dedicated winemakers. Bergström Winery is one of those renowned wineries. Family owned gem in Willamette Valley, they are committed to sustainable practices and biodynamic farming creating a harmonious relationship with their land.

Bergström Wines traces its roots to 1999. Founded by Dr. John , a physician with a passion for agriculture with his son Josh, purchased 13 acres of land in the Dundee Hills, a prime wine growing region in the Willamette Valley. Their focus is on creating a sustainable and biodynamic farming approach, aiming to produce wines that truly reflected the unique terroir of the region.

Over the years, the winery has expanded its holdings to include multiple estate vineyards, each with its distinct characteristics. Their commitment to biodynamic farming practices has garnered widespread recognition, as it helps to maintain the delicate balance of the ecosystem and produce wines that are both flavorful and environmentally sustainable. Bergström Cumberland Reserve 2021

Willamette Valley Pinot Noir is incredible for three reasions: the climate, the soil and the dedicated winemakers. Oregonian style is all about balance and, from estate to estate, a personality that comes first from the soil, then, so often, from the family.

Pours into the glass a bright deep ruby hue with hints of garnet at the rim.

Electric aromas of ripe red berries - a cranberry extravaganza mixed with sweet strawberry, cherry, pomegranate potting soil and savory forest floor with subtle hints of violet, raspberry leaf, fresh tobacco and clove.

That first sip is absolute dynamite - succulent fruit is incredibly balanced with the zesty acidity and supple structure. A medium bodied beauty with silkier than silk tannins. The Bergström captures the haunting allure of this fiesty devil of a grape. Purity of flavor, high voltage elegance with an enduring earthy clove finale.

Paired with a charcoal grilled spiced beer can chicken smoked with cherry wood chips. .
